Coding for Climate Change
A project sponsored by the National Geographic Society. 8 Python lessons connected to topics in climate science.
Coding is for everyone! Created by an educator with no computer science background, this resource consists of a simple, easy-to-follow coding program for high school students and educators of all backgrounds and comfort levels to learn Python while learning about geographic and scientific issues related to climate change. Each lesson begins with a new climate change topic and then introduces a step-by-step coding lesson.

With support from the National Geographic Society, French-language resources are now available! These include a student workshop in the form of a slide presentation for select lessons, along with a quiz to help students test their knowledge after completing the workshop.
